Price for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ids in South Korea (CIF) - 2022
In December 2022, the average industrial monocarboxylic fatty acids import price amounted to $856 per ton, dropping by -5.4% against the previous month. Over the period under review, the import price recorded a perceptible downturn.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in April 2022 an increase of 17% against the previous month. As a result, import price reached the peak level of $1,493 per ton. From May 2022 to December 2022, the average import prices remained at a somewhat lower figure.
Average prices varied noticeably amongst the major supplying countries. In December 2022, the highest price was recorded for prices from China ($949 per ton) and Malaysia ($886 per ton), while the price for Vietnam ($806 per ton) and Indonesia ($807 per ton) were amongst the lowest.
From December 2021 to December 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by China (+1.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.
Price for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ids in South Korea (FOB) - 2022
In December 2022, the average industrial monocarboxylic fatty acids export price amounted to $2,112 per ton, remaining stable against the previous month. Over the period under review, export price indicated a measured increase from December 2021 to December 2022: its price increased at an average monthly rate of +2.8% over the last twelve months.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on December 2022 figures, industrial monocarboxylic fatty acids export price decreased by -16.4% against August 2022 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in May 2022 when the average export price increased by 38% m-o-m. The export price peaked at $2,525 per ton in August 2022; however, from September 2022 to December 2022, the export prices failed to regain momentum.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major external markets. In December 2022, the country with the highest price was Japan ($4,292 per ton), while the average price for exports to the Philippines ($1,082 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2021 to December 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Malaysia (+11.4%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Imports of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ids in South Korea
In 2022, approx. 419K tons of industrial monocarboxylic fatty acids were imported into South Korea; which is down by -6.1% on the previous year. The total import volume increased at an average annual rate of +1.8% from 2019 to 2022; the trend pattern remained consistent, with somewhat noticeable fluctuations being observed in certain years.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 14%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of 446K tons, and then shrank in the following year.
In value terms, industrial monocarboxylic fatty acids imports declined significantly to $315M in 2022. Over the period under review, imports, however, showed strong growth.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 98% against the previous year. As a result, imports reached the peak of $419M, and then fell significantly in the following year.
Import of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ids in South Korea (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Indonesia | 81.5 | 88.2 | 252 | 189 | 32.4% |
Malaysia | 81.2 | 101 | 115 | 86.3 | 2.1% |
China | 3.2 | 6.6 | 24.9 | 18.7 | 80.1% |
Thailand | 6.4 | 5.2 | 8.0 | 6.0 | -2.1% |
United States | 5.7 | 2.5 | 2.2 | 2.7 | -22.0% |
Others | 14.0 | 8.5 | 16.9 | 12.2 | -4.5% |
Total | 192 | 212 | 419 | 315 | 17.9% |
Top Suppliers of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ids to South Korea in 2022:
- Indonesia (229.6K tons)
- Malaysia (134.8K tons)
- China (32.2K tons)
- Thailand (6.7K tons)
- United States (6.6K tons)
Exports of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ids in South Korea
After three years of growth, shipments abroad of industrial monocarboxylic fatty acids decreased by -1.7% to 5.2K tons in 2022. Overall, exports, however, recorded a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when exports increased by 3.6%. As a result, the exports attained the peak of 5.3K tons, and then dropped modestly in the following year.
In value terms, industrial monocarboxylic fatty acids exports fell to $6.7M in 2022. Over the period under review, total exports indicated a prominent increase from 2019 to 2022: its value increased at an average annual rate of +8.6% over the last three-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, exports increased by +28.1% against 2019 indices.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 when exports increased by 37% against the previous year.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$7.7M, and then declined in the following year.
Export of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ids in South Korea (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
China | 2,851 | 3,465 | 5,464 | 4,458 | 16.1% |
Malaysia | 378 | 368 | 732 | 597 | 16.5% |
Taiwan (Chinese) | 418 | 36.1 | 599 | 489 | 5.4% |
Indonesia | 627 | 603 | 217 | 388 | -14.8% |
Vietnam | 370 | 574 | 142 | 291 | -7.7% |
Philippines | 315 | 192 | 181 | 184 | -16.4% |
Japan | 158 | 207 | 221 | 180 | 4.4% |
India | 31.4 | 168 | 44.9 | 65.6 | 27.8% |
Others | 50.0 | 6.2 | 93.8 | 4.3 | -55.9% |
Total | 5,199 | 5,621 | 7,695 | 6,658 | 8.6% |
Top Export Markets for Industrial Monocarboxylic Fatty Acids from South Korea in 2022:
- China (3155.4 tons)
- Malaysia (689.3 tons)
- Indonesia (422.3 tons)
- Taiwan (Chinese) (298.4 tons)
- Vietnam (261.7 tons)
- Philippines (191.2 tons)
- India (125.1 tons)
- Japan (81.3 tons)
